On 2015-02-25T11:15:43+00:00 Rémi Verschelde wrote: Testing sddm 0.11.0 on Mageia 5 pre-RC, I see that there is an issue with the keyboard layout. "en_US" is preselected and is the only available option, I can't use the "fr" keyboard layout even though my system locale is French. Reproducible: Steps to Reproduce: Reply at: https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/sddm/+bug/1458220/comments/0 On 2015-02-25T12:12:58+00:00 Rémi Verschelde wrote: This would be this upstream bug: https://github.com/sddm/sddm/issues/202 Reply at: https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/sddm/+bug/1458220/comments/1 On 2015-02-25T12:14:43+00:00 Rémi Verschelde wrote: I have the same behaviour as some reported on the upstream bug report by the way: the flag is initially "us", but as soon as I start typing my password, it switches to "fr". Thanks. > > -- > You received this bug notification because you are subscribed to the bug > report. > https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/883319 > > Title: > xrandr --scale restricts area in which mouse moves > > Status in X.Org X server: > Incomplete > Status in xorg-server package in Ubuntu: > Fix Released > Status in xorg-server source package in Precise: > Fix Released > Status in xorg-server source package in Quantal: > Fix Released > Status in xorg-server source package in Raring: > Fix Released > > Bug description: > SRU Request: > > [IMPACT] > A bug in the version of xorg-server in precise prevents users from > scaling screen resolution. When attempting to do so, as was possible in > Natty and earlier, and which is possible in Quantal+, the mouse pointer > remains locked inside the old resolution. This prevents users of small > screens such as netbooks from scaling to a greater screen resolution. > > [Test Case] > - On a netbook with intel chipset, such as a Dell Mini 9 or 10, scale > the display by using the following command: > > xrandr --output LVDS1 --panning 1280x750 --scale 1.25x1.25 > > See if the mouse moves correctly to all screen extremities, and is not > confined by a transparent border at 1024x600 > > [Regression Potential] > This is fixed with a patch backported from the xorg-server version in > Quantal. In theory it should just affect screen which are scaled and > panned, which is uncommon. If so, the patch can be backed out. > > > > Original Bug Description: > in kubuntu (and ubuntu) 11.04 i used to enlarge my laptop screen like so > > xrandr --output LVDS1 --scale 1.2x1.2 > > this worked fine: the desktop scaled to larger size correctly . >After upgrading to 11.10, in kde the desktop still resizes > correctly, but the movement of the mouse is restricted to an area equal > to > the screen size *before* issuing the scaling command. .. Ie let's say > the mode is 1366x768 and I do xrandr --output LVDS1 --scale 1.2x1.2 the > screen size changes to 1640x922 but the mouse moves in an area the size > of > 1366x768 in the top left of the screen and then 'hits a wall' preventing > it to move. I also tried ubuntu 11.10 with gnome: here the screen also > resizes, but I have the same issue with the mouse, and the extended area > of the desktop is black... > > Some time ago there was a similar issue, which was resolved later.
